There are some areas in the Lincoln National Forest in south central NM that I have spent quite a bit of time in about 15 years ago. Beautiful area. It is north of McKittrick Canyon. To get there, take Co Rd. 412 (Guadalupe Ridge Rd) south, off of Hwy 137 (the turn-off is west of Queen). There is quite a lot to explore back there. Here is a link (not mine, Google!!) that shows a hiking trip in that area: http://thecommonmilkweed.blogspot.com/2009/11/dog-canyon-to-mckittrick-canyon-through.html
Here is a link to a map of the area (look at the area map): http://www.nps.gov/gumo/planyourvisit/maps.htm

I don't remember any of the trails being tight, but it has been a while and things do change over time.
